Intuition is the ability to acquire knowledge without inference; to look inside or to contemplate. Intuition is thus often conceived as a kind of inner perception.
The right brain is popularly associated with intuitive processes such as aesthetic or generally creative abilities. Some scientists have contended that intuition is associated with innovation in scientific discovery.
